Heterotic Strings and Quantum Entanglement

Abstract

We construct Z_N orbifolds of the ten-dimensional heterotic string theories appropriate for implementing the stringy replica method for the calculation of quantum entanglement entropy. A novel feature for the heterotic string is that the gauge symmetry must be broken by a Wilson line to ensure modular invariance. We completely classify the patterns of symmetry breaking. We show that the tachyonic contributions in all cases can be analytically continued, with a finite answer in the domain 0<N ≤ 1, relevant for calculating entanglement entropy across the Rindler horizon. We discuss the physical implications of our results.
